SUMMARY:2021 SDGs Learning\, Training and Practice
DESCRIPTION:Co-organized by the United Nations Department of Economic and Social Affairs\, Division for Sustainable Development Goals (DESA/DSDG) and the United Nations Institute for Training and Research (UNITAR) New York Office \nA Special Event of the 2021 High-level Political Forum on Sustainable Development under the auspices of ECOSOC \nTo be held virtually \nThe 2021 United Nations High-level Political Forum on Sustainable Development\, convened under the auspices of the Economic and Social Council\, will be held from Tuesday\, 6 July\, to Thursday\, 15 July 2021. \nThe Division for Sustainable Development Goals (DSDG)\, at the United Nations Department of Economic and Social Affairs (UN DESA/DSDG) and the United Nations Institute for Training and Research (UNITAR)\, New York Office\, are organizing the 2021 edition of the SDGs Learning\, Training & Practice – a series of capacity building and knowledge learning sessions held as a Special Event to the HLPF\, featuring speakers and experts from many sectors on crucial topics related to the implementation of the SDGs under review in 2021. \nIn the 2021 HLPF\, participants will be able to explore various aspects of the response to the COVID-19 pandemic and the various measures and types of international cooperation that can control the pandemic and its impacts and put the world back on track to achieve the SDGs by 2030\, within the decade of action and delivery for sustainable development. \n1. Theme\nThe SDG Learning\, Training and Practice Special Event will align with the 2021 HLPF theme: “Sustainable and resilient recovery from the COVID-19 pandemic that promotes the economic\, social and environmental dimensions of sustainable development: building an inclusive and effective path for the achievement of the 2030 Agenda in the context of the decade of action and delivery for sustainable development”. \nIt will also be aligned with the set of SDGs to be reviewed in depth at the 2021 HLPF:  \nSDG 1: End poverty in all its forms everywhere.\nSDG 2: End hunger\, achieve food security and improved nutrition and promote sustainable agriculture.\nSDG 3: Ensure healthy lives and promote well-being for all at all ages.\nSDG 8: Promote sustained\, inclusive and sustainable economic growth\, full and productive employment and decent work for all.\nSDG 10: Reduce inequality within and among countries.\nSDG 12: Ensure sustainable consumption and production patterns.\nSDG13: Take urgent action to combat climate change and its impacts.\nSDG 16: Promote peaceful and inclusive societies for sustainable development\, provide access to justice for all and build effective\, accountable and inclusive institutions at all levels.\nSDG 17: Strengthen the means of implementation and revitalize the global partnership for sustainable development.\n2. Format\nThe 2021 SDGs Learning\, Training and Practice Special event will be held in a virtual format via an online meetings platform. However\, conditions permitting\, the organizers will explore the possibility of hosting a few sessions at the UN Headquarters\, in New York.  \nTen learning sessions will be organized and distributed in the first five days of the HLPF (6\, 7\, 8\, 9 and 12 July). Each 1.5-hour long session will be organized by national governments and relevant stakeholders selected through an open application process.  \nUNITAR and UNDESA will provide the online platform for the sessions\, coordinate participants registration\, outreach and reporting.  \n3. Output\nThe 2021 SDGs Learning\, Training & Practice workshops aim to advance: \nKnowledge and skills acquisition\nNetworking\nSharing experiences and peer to peer collaboration\nLearning about practical actions and best practices\nCapacity building\nPractical policy integration and coherence\nAll sessions will be livestreamed\, recorded\, and open to all interested participants. A dedicated page will be set up at the 2021 HLPF website to promote information about the different sessions. \nA summary report will be produced by DESA and UNITAR. \n4. SUMMARY:Virtual 2021 Global Girl Up Leadership Summit
DESCRIPTION:About this event\nA two-day virtual Summit bringing together movers and changemakers from around the globe committed to gender equality presented by P&G and its brands Always and Whisper. \nCan’t wait for the 2021 Global Leadership Summit? From July 7-12\, we’re visiting a region near you for the Leadership Summit Tour\, tackling topics that are important to communities around the world. Once you’ve registered for Summit you’ll be invited to join the Tour. \nWho is the Virtual 2021 Global Girl Up Leadership Summit for? \n• Changemakers of all ages \n• The motivated and fearless \n• Those who know they can make a difference and that together we are stronger \n• Those with big\, bold\, ideas \n• Those ready to be a leader \n• YOU! \nAbout Girl Up \nNo matter their background\, girls have the power to transform themselves\, their communities\, and the world around them. Girl Up is a global movement of empowered young women leaders who defend gender equality. Through leadership development training\, Girl Up gives girls the resources and platform to start a movement for social change wherever they are. For those who stand with us in this movement\, there is no rest until we achieve equal rights for every girl. Because when girls rise\, we all rise. \nGirl Up was founded by the United Nations Foundation in 2010 and continues to work across a global community of partners to achieve gender equality worldwide.\nGirl Up’s Commitment \nAll Girl Up programs are open and inclusive of any youth regardless of gender identity\, race\, religion\, ethnicity\, political belief\, socioeconomic status\, sexual orientation\, physical ability\, or other identity.
